Around 300 square meters of vibrant space. That’s Galleria Giovanni Bonelli in Milan. A haven for contemporary art. It’s more than just a gallery. It’s a story. A transformation.
Before it became a celebrated gallery this location held a different energy. In the 1980s Binario Zero filled this space. It pulsed with live music. The walls echoed with the sounds of concerts. Imagine the change. From rock and roll to refined art.
Giovanni Bonelli a seasoned gallerist with over a decade of experience created this space. He added it to his existing Bonelli LAB in Canneto sull’Oglio. Bonelli sought to showcase contemporary Italian and international art. He breathes new life into these walls.
The gallery showcases both emerging artists and established masters. It presents a dynamic view of the art world. Its exhibitions blend youthful energy with established talent. It’s a cultural crossroads. A place where different styles and generations meet.
